How Do I Turn a Garden Shed Into a Man Cave?
In the UK, garden rooms have become a popular solution. Companies like Green Retreats offer pre-designed structures that can serve as home bars, cinemas, or workshops. The process typically involves choosing a size, adding insulation, running electricity, and then furnishing to taste. Costs vary but a basic garden man cave starts around £5,000.

The Psychology of a Man Cave – Why Men Need Their Own Space
The psychological rationale behind man caves goes beyond simple comfort. Research shows that having a dedicated personal area can lower stress, reinforce identity, and improve relationships by giving each partner a place of their own.
What Does a Man Cave Say About a Man’s Personality?
Personalisation of space is a form of self-expression. A man cave filled with sports memorabilia, for instance, signals a connection to team identity and competition, while a workshop suggests a hands-on, creative temperament. Psychologists note that such environments can serve as “third places” – a retreat from work and home responsibilities.
Can a Man Cave Improve Relationships?
Contrary to the stereotype of a man cave as a relationship-killer, many couples report that having a separate zone for each partner reduces conflict. A 2022 study cited in the HelpGuide notes that personal space can improve relationship satisfaction by allowing individuals to decompress before reconnecting.

Man Cave UK and Mental Health Support Groups
One of the most significant developments in the man cave landscape is the emergence of “The Man Cave UK” – a free-to-attend mental health support group for men. Unlike the physical room, this man cave is a community space.
According to the group’s website, The Man Cave UK provides a safe, non-judgmental environment where men can discuss their mental health openly. The group meets in the MK (Milton Keynes) and NN (Northampton) postcode areas, with plans to expand nationally.
What Is The Man Cave UK?
It is a support group – not a building. Men of any age can attend for free. Activities go beyond conversation; members participate in cold water dips, axe throwing, and walking groups to build camaraderie and reduce the clinical feel of traditional therapy.

How Much Does a Custom Man Cave Cost?
Costs vary dramatically. A simple DIY conversion of a garage corner may cost under £500. A premium garden room from a specialist like Green Retreats typically starts around £5,000 and can exceed £30,000 with custom interiors, plumbing, and entertainment systems.
